在数字货币逐渐被大众所接受的今天,各类钱包应用也纷纷涌现,成为用户存储、管理数字资产的重要工具。其中,...
随着数字货币与区块链技术的迅速发展,越来越多的人希望了解其核心概念,尤其是共识机制。共识机制是区块链网络中为了达成一致意见而采用的一种算法,它确保所有参与者在没有中心化管理的情况下,共同认可区块链上的交易数据。本篇文章将详细解析区块链的共识机制特点,并讨论几个相关问题,帮助读者深入理解这一重要话题。
区块链技术的独特之处在于其去中心化的特点,而去中心化的实施依赖于共识机制。它确保所有参与网络的节点能够就添加到区块链中的数据达成共识。不同的区块链网络可能会采用不同的共识机制,最常见的几种包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)、实用拜占庭容错(PBFT)等。
1. **去中心化**:共识机制允许多个参与者独立验证和确认交易,避免了中心化模式下的单点故障风险。
2. **安全性**:通过复杂的计算和算法,共识机制能够抵御外部攻击和恶意行为,保障数据的安全与完整。
3. **透明性**:所有参与者都可以看到区块链上的交易记录,从而提升了交易的透明度。
4. **效率性**:不同的共识机制在处理交易的速度和效率上各有千秋,选择合适的机制对区块链网络的性能至关重要。
5. **节能性**:一些新型共识机制(如PoS)越来越重视能耗问题,力求降低区块链运行时所需的电力消耗。
工作量证明是一种通过计算机算力来验证交易的共识机制。使用PoW机制的著名例子有比特币网络。它的安全性来自于这样一个事实:要攻击网络,攻击者需要拥有超过50%的算力,才能伪造交易。这导致了攻击的成本极高,因此相对安全。
虽然PoW提供了较好的安全性,但其缺点是能耗巨大且验证交易的速度较慢。随着参与者增多,竞争加剧,挖矿的难度会不断提高,进一步导致资源消耗的增加成本。因此,虽然PoW机制确保了安全性,但其可持续性受到质疑,且在某些情况下可能导致中心化趋势的出现。
权益证明(PoS)是对工作量证明的回应,其验证机制不依赖算力,而是根据持有的数字货币数量来选择区块生产者。这意味着拥有更多代币的用户能够更有可能被选中生产新区块。
PoS的优点在于其能效显著优于PoW,因其无需进行消耗大量电力的计算过程。同时,区块产生的速度也更快,确认交易的时间更短。然而,PoS也面临一些挑战,比如“富者愈富”的现象,即拥有大量代币的用户将掌握更多的控制权,可能导致网络的集中化。
选择共识机制时需考虑多个因素,包括目标网络的使用场景、交易频率、安全需求和可扩展性。例如,如果是目标于高频交易及快速确认的应用,可能优先考虑DPoS或PBFT等快速共识机制;而对于强调安全性和抗攻击能力的数字货币,则PoW或某种变体可能更合适。
此外,可扩展性也是一个重要考量点,随着用户数量的增加,网络的吞吐量需要能够保持稳定。因此,一些新兴的混合型共识机制开始出现,试图融合不同机制的优点,通过分层结构实现安全性与效率的平衡。
随着区块链技术的发展,许多新型的共识机制相继推出,旨在解决现有机制的不足。比如,Nakamoto Consensus创立的“工作量证明”正在被大量新机制所取代,如权益证明和混合共识机制。此外,随着对环保与可持续性的关注增加,许多项目也开始探讨如何在保持安全的同时,降低能量消耗,如直观性共识机制(PoInc)等新兴方式。
此外,去中心化金融(DeFi)和非同质化代币(NFT)的兴起也对共识机制产生了影响,这些用例要求更高的交易处理速度和低延迟,这可能会推动更多创新机制的出现。
区块链共识机制的演进将直接影响金融、法律、供应链等多个领域。通过提高交易的透明度和安全性,很多传统的行业流程将被重构。例如,在供应链管理中,采用透明的共识机制能够有效追踪产品的来源与流通状态,确保产品的质量与真实性。
此外,随着去中心化金融(DeFi)的发展,共识机制能够使金融产品的创造与交易过程变得更高效,降低参与门槛,让大众能够更轻松地参与金融市场。这不仅促进了资本的有效利用,也推动了经济的普惠发展。
总之,区块链的共识机制是支撑其去中心化特性与安全性的基石。迎接未来,继续关注这一领域的创新和演变,将为我们展现出更为广阔的数字经济与社会发展的前景。